BSF Soldier Injured as Pakistan Violates Ceasefire Near LoC; Indian Troops Retaliate Swiftly

A Border Security Force (BSF) staff was harmed early Wednesday following a truce infringement by Pakistani forces along the Line of Control (LoC) close to Jammu.
The occurrence happened around 2:35 am in the Akhnoor area, where Pakistani Officers opened ridiculous fire. Accordingly, the BSF fought back properly.
The BSF representative, cited by news organization , affirmed the injury to one of their staff. Following the terminating, Indian soldiers positioned along both the Worldwide Boundary and the LoC have been put fully on guard.

This infringement comes straight ahead of the impending Jammu and Kashmir gathering races, which are set to happen in three stages: on September 18, 25, and October 1. This will stamp the main gathering political decision in the locale in 10 years.
